Candace Owens raises new questions as she seeks footage of Egyptians she claims came to Provo before Charlie Kirk’s death
Candace Owens raises new questions as she seeks footage of Egyptians she claims came to Provo before Charlie Kirk’s death (Image via Getty)

Candace Owens is once again talking about the death of Charlie Kirk, and she claims she has a new “major break” in the case. On November 26, 2025, she shared new claims on X. She said a person who was “directly involved” in booking hotel rooms told her that a group she calls “Egyptians” came to Provo on September 4, 2025. She also said they stayed at the La Quinta Inn & Suites on University Parkway in Orem until September 13, 2025. Candace Owens called this a big clue and asked people in Utah to check any cameras they have from those days. She told shop owners and hotel workers that someone near the hotel “may hold the key” to what happened. These claims are not proven, and she has not shared any records or videos to support them. The Jerusalem Post also reported her statements.Candace Owens asks Utah shops and hotel workers to share video from early SeptemberIn her post on X, Candace Owens wrote that she is “now looking for FOOTAGE.” She said people who live or work near the La Quinta Inn & Suites should check cameras from September 4 to September 13. She asked anyone who remembers something strange to email her team. She claimed that these “Egyptians” came into Utah days before Charlie Kirk was killed on September 10, 2025. But again, she did not show proof. These are only claims made online.Candace Owens later posted a second message. In that message, she hinted that the FBI may have already taken any hotel footage. She wrote, “And if we find out the FBI seized the footage already…” But she did not provide any evidence to show the FBI did this. Authorities have not said anything about her new claim, and there is no official confirmation that these “Egyptians” exist or stayed at the hotel.The Jerusalem Post said that Owens has made many big claims since Charlie Kirk’s death. The paper reported that she has also shared fears about her own safety and has talked about foreign groups and leaders in earlier posts. But none of these ideas have been proven by officials.Candace Owens continues to ask the public to send her tips, videos, or receipts from the days before and after Charlie Kirk’s death. Her posts are bringing strong reactions online. Some people believe her, while others say she is sharing serious claims without facts.
